The Awards

Taking place on Wednesday 13th June, the 2012 awards will be held at Wembley Stadium. Now in their 19th year, the Craft Guild of Chefs Awards have become the chef’s ‘Oscars’, and the coveted accolades recognise and reward the leading talent working in kitchens all across the industry. There are now 15 different award categories for which nominations are sought, covering all aspects of the chef profession, from education to pubs and from the cost sector to banqueting. The 16th award is reserved for one special person who the judges think has made an outstanding contribution to the industry as a whole.

A brand new category has been added to the Awards line up for 2012 – the Armed Services Chef Award. The Craft Guild of Chefs believe that feeding the country’s military personnel is a demanding and varied occupation which deserves to be recognised.

The judges will be looking for someone who has had an outstanding career and achieved excellence over many years of service, or has shown dedication over and above the call of duty. If you know of a serving military chef that fits this bill who you believe should be held up as a shining example, we are now inviting nominations for this overdue award – please see the full criteria on the next page.

The winning candidates in all categories are announced at the prestigious awards ceremony, which itself has become an unmissable event in the industry calendar, with more than 600 of the country’s culinary professionals gathering under one roof to celebrate with their peers.

As the Guild continues to go from strength to strength, with an expanding membership and programme of initiatives, it strives to promote culinary excellence at every opportunity and the awards are just one of the many ways to celebrate the stars of our fabulous industry.
